Description
In the 1950s Robert Coles began monitoring, living among, and, most importantly, hearing American kids. The outcomes of his efforts--unveiled in five volumes published between 1977 and 1967 --represent one of the very energetic and searching cultural studies previously performed by one individual within the Usa. Below, observed frequently within their own comments, are America's "children of disaster": African American children captured in the throes of the South's racial incorporation; The children of impoverished migrant workers in Appalachia; Children whose families were changed by the migration from South to North, from rural to urban communities; Latino, Native American, and Eskimo children in the poorest communities of the American West; The children of America's richest families facing the responsibility of the own opportunity. This quantity maintains to produce a masterwork of sociological and psychological query--a book that, in its concentrate on how children develop and learn in the facial skin of cultural turmoil and rapid change, talks specifically and pointedly to the own situations.
